The resurrection is astonishing and the resurrection is true. We all have a different response to the resurrection of what we come to celebrate today. There are those that believe in the resurrection but just reject it. When Jesus asks, “Do you love Me,” are you going to reject the invitation or are you going to repent? The resurrection is astonishing and true, but the question is, “What will you do?” Listen to this Easter service message.
